Academic Progress

3/10

Students at this school are making less academic progress from one grade to the next compared to students at other schools in the state.

Low progress with low test scores means students are starting at a low point and are falling even farther behind their peers at other schools in the state.

Test Scores

1/10

Test scores at this school fall far below the state average. This suggests that students at this school are likely not performing at grade level.

From the School

We provide a rigorous STEM-based curriculum


Washington Elementary STEM Magnet provides a rigorous Science Technology Engineering and Mathematics-based curriculum that addresses the needs of each student. Our students become responsible scientifically and technologically literate global citizens through the development of critical thinking communication collaboration and creative skills. We strive to provide our students with a world-class STEM experience to prepare them for future academic and career success.
